by Alice O'Connor, Apr 20, 2011 7:00am PDTIn a characteristically hilarious blog post, Valve has revealed that six Team Fortress 2 hats have snuck into Portal 2's co-op mode.
Should you own any of the following hats in TF2, you'll now be able to wear them in Portal 2 too:
- Mann Co. Cap
- Prince Tavish's Crown
- Pyro's Beanie
- Fancy Fedora
- Master's Yellow Belt
- Tyrant's Helm
Portal 2, if you were unaware, has character customisation for the two co-op bots. Players can equip Atlas and P-Body with new gestures, paint patterns, accessories, and, of course, hats. Some can be unlocked with achievements, while many more are sold through the Robot Enrichment program--essentially a Portal 2 version of TF2's Mann Co. Store.
